Output f1ac541cbdea876a891450b017e696b936db637c83e860b236babc0861e4aec7:3

value
21289973
script pubkey
OP_HASH160 OP_PUSHBYTES_20 641beb07242c3be831ef75cf4e1c1db87561c246 OP_EQUAL
address
MH2VFPsxqYz61XKh4voDTHjoJN2AtGfDu1
transaction
f1ac541cbdea876a891450b017e696b936db637c83e860b236babc0861e4aec7
spent
true